Handover — Reception, Brackenfield House

Morning — a few things from my shift. Locker assignments in the staff changing rooms were reshuffled yesterday; the updated list is in the blue folder under the desk. Three people still need to collect their new locker tags: they're in the labelled envelopes in the top drawer. If anyone asks, lockers 12 and 19 are out of service pending repair. The changing room door code changed last night and is noted below.

turnstile pass: bdg-FVNQRS-72965873

Ticket #— Floor 9 Opening Prep, Brindlemoor House

Hi facilities folks, Floor 9 opens to staff next Monday and we need a few things squared away before then. Lift access is live, but the two side doors by the kitchenette are still on the old lock config — please reprogram them before Friday. Also, signage for the quiet rooms hasn't arrived, so pop up the temporary printed ones for now. Until the badge readers sync, the interim door code for Floor 9 is below.

door code, bajop-bajog: bdg-DSWAC-43621

The shrinkwrap CLI resizes image batches for the Pondmark catalog. Run it from the worker node only; laptops lack the codec pack. Output lands in the staging bucket and is swept nightly. Before the first run on a fresh host, the storage access secret must be appended to the env file on the next line.

vault entry, yahif-yajep: COURIER_KEY29=b802bdf8034096b65a51c6ba5abe2

# Routefox driver-assignment heuristic — environment file
# New folks: this file configures the Hoplite scorer, which ranks available
# drivers by proximity, shift fatigue, and vehicle class. Weights below are
# tuned weekly by the dispatch team in Bremworth; do not adjust them locally.
# HOPLITE_PROXIMITY_WEIGHT and HOPLITE_FATIGUE_WEIGHT must sum to less than 1.0
# or the scorer rejects the config at startup. Keep this file out of commits.
# The scorer's API credential is declared on the very next line.

env line for tawig-kadup: VAULT_KEY5=07c4f